prekybai
Prekybai is a Lithuanian term that generally refers to the act of trading or commerce. The word is derived from the Lithuanian root "prekyba," which denotes trade, business, or commerce. In a broader context, prekybai encompasses various forms of economic exchanges, including the buying and selling of goods and services within local, national, or international markets.
